Mathieu Perrin 1664–1742 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 21 Sep 1664

Birth Location: Montreal, Quebec, Canada

Death Date: 27 Jul 1742

Death Location: Ste-Anne-de-Bellevue, Quebec, Canada

Father: Henri Perrin

Mother: Jeanne Merrin

Spouse(s): Marie Pilet

Children(s): Isabella Perrin

In 1664, Mathieu Perrin entered the world in Montreal, Quebec, Canada, born to Henri Perrin And Jeanne Merrin. Mathieu Perrin married Marie Jeanne Therese Pilet, and had children including Isabella Ester Easter Perrin. Mathieu Perrin passed away in 1742 in Ste-Anne-de-Bellevue, Quebec, Canada.
